# Temple, Texas - June 1961

A witness in Temple reported seeing a bright object in the night sky in early June 1961. The observer described the object as similar in appearance to a star, though noticeably brighter and larger. The sighting lasted about three minutes.

The Air Force investigators noted uncertainty about the exact date of the sighting. They considered whether the object might have been ECHO I, a large satellite launched by NASA, but concluded they could not verify this without a confirmed date. The investigators also suggested the duration of the sighting could indicate an aircraft, though the limited information made a definitive conclusion difficult.

The case evaluation form indicates the investigators could not reach a firm conclusion. The file notes list the case as marked for "insufficient data for evaluation." On the cover sheet, the Air Force ultimately classified this sighting as unidentified.
